“I just report the news and the truth can hurt sometimes,” Charania said during a Monday appearance on The Pat McAfee Show (Twitter video links). “… If (the Bucks) spent as much time dealing with their own internal problems as they did responding to accurate reports, they wouldn’t be in the mess that they’re in right now. … I’m just here to document and cover it the right way.”
Eric Nehm of The Athletic shares his own reporting on a disappointing Bucks season, citing multiple league sources who say that Rivers told several veteran players following a March 21 shootaround in Phoenix that he thought they’d “failed him.” The coach also questioned their “commitment, conditioning, focus, and leadership,” according to Nehm, who said those vets didn’t take kindly to Rivers’ remarks. “That’s when I checked out on this season,” one player told The Athletic.
In an interview with Mark Medina of EssentiallySports, Bucks broadcaster Marques Johnson said that the Antetokounmpo saga in Milwaukee – including a disagreement between the star forward and the team about his health – is “as toxic as it appears,” referring to it as a “bad situation.”

Re: NBA 25-26 - And so it begins..
From ESPN...
"We showed a video this morning, that these guys have all been in the NCAA tournament," Orlando coach Jamahl Mosley said. "You talk about the 'One Shining Moment.' These guys have all played there, they know you're one-and-done. And that was it tonight.
"You either have a chance to end your season or start a new one. That defense in the first half was probably about as elite as we have seen in a while."
Friday's game was a blueprint for how Orlando is designed to play. The Magic bullied the Hornets with their physicality on both ends, played suffocating defense that forced 14 first-half turnovers, which Orlando turned into 22 points, and looked like the team that entered the season expected to be a top-four unit in the East.
"When you play with a sense of desperation and urgency, when you know you're either going home or extending your season, that's what it looks like," Mosley said. "There [are] no second chances."
